
Ph.D. in Nursing
Designed to prepare nurse scholars for a lifetime of advanced research in clinical practice or academia, Seton Hall University's flagship Ph.D. in Nursing program is helping to shape the next generation of intellectual leadership in nursing. Through scholarly inquiry, graduates of the program will continue the pipeline of nurse scientists to advance knowledge in nursing education, clinical practice and administration.

A Flexible Experience
Students can pursue this degree through full- or part-time study. Participate in classes synchronously online or in person.
